Course Content

• Introduction to Nanoscale Physics and Nanotechnology
• Quantum Mechanics for Nanostructures
• Nanoscale Fabrication Techniques (including Lithography and self-assembly)
• Characterization of Nanomaterials (microscopy, spectroscopy)
• Electronic and Optical Properties of Nanomaterials
• Nanomaterials for Energy Applications (solar cells, batteries)
• Nanobiotechnology and Biomedical Applications
• Nanoscale Devices and Sensors
• Advanced Topics in Nanophysics (e.g., topological insulators, graphene)
• Research Project in Nanoscale Nanophysics

Career Role Description
Nanoscience Research Scientist Conducting cutting-edge research in nanoscale materials and their applications. High demand for PhD level expertise in advanced nanomaterials and characterisation techniques.
Nanotechnology Engineer Developing and implementing nanotechnology solutions across diverse sectors like electronics, medicine and energy. Strong analytical and problem-solving skills are crucial in this rapidly evolving field.
Materials Scientist (Nanomaterials Focus) Specialising in the synthesis, processing, and characterization of nanomaterials with a focus on their properties and applications in various industries. A solid understanding of nanoscale physics is essential.
Applications Scientist (Nanotechnology) Working closely with clients to apply nanotechnology solutions to real-world problems and translate research into commercial products. Excellent communication and collaboration skills are key.
